photogrammetry
/foh-tuh-gram-i-tree/US // ˌfoʊ təˈgræm ɪ tri //UK // (ˌfəʊtəʊˈɡræmɪtrɪ) //

Definitions
n.名词 noun
- 1
- : the process of making surveys and maps through the use of photographs, especially aerial photographs.
Examples
That’s why photogrammetry, the practice of capturing 3D information with sonar, lidar, and digital cameras, is now de rigueur at almost every major excavation site.
For example, we’re using photogrammetry to make characters and objects ultra-realistic.
